1 dead after New Year’s Day crash on Pa. Turnpike

One person died early New Year’s Day following a crash on the Pennsylvania Turnpike in Carbon County, authorities said.

Initial reports indicate a male pedestrian was struck by a vehicle. He was pronounced dead at 4:40 a.m. Thursday.

The crash occurred at mile marker 76.2 just north of the Mahoning Valley Interchange, Exit 74, in Franklin Township…
